Jey Uso Beats Brother Jimmy Uso at WWE WrestleMania 40 After Entering with Lil Wayne
April 7, 2024
Jey Uso defeated his twin brother, Jimmy Uso, in a first-ever match between the two on Night 1 of WrestleMania 40 on Saturday.
Lil Wayne notably accompanied the eventual winner out to the ring:

The twins had seemed destined to reconcile at one point in the match, but Jimmy used the moment to trick his brother.
However, Jey claimed victory after hitting a Spear and then an Uso Splash.
The bout marked only the third time in WWE history that biological brothers faced each other at WrestleMania, joining Bret Hart vs. Owen Hart from WrestleMania 10 and Jeff Hardy vs. Matt Hardy from WrestleMania 25.
Jey and Jimmy made their WWE main roster debut together in 2010, and over the next 13 years they established themselves as one of the greatest tag teams in the history of WWE and pro wrestling as a whole.
The Usos beat Roman Reigns and Solo Sikoa in a Bloodline Civil War match at Money in the Bank 2023, which set the stage for Jey to challenge Reigns for the Undisputed WWE Universal Championship at SummerSlam in Tribal Combat.
Just when it seemed Jey was about to beat Reigns and overtake his cousin for the role of Tribal Chief, Jimmy shockingly interfered and cost him the match.
Jimmy later explained that he was afraid of the power going to Jey's head and him becoming like Reigns, but when Jey officially left The Bloodline and SmackDown for Raw, Jimmy fully aligned himself with The Tribal Chief again.
In the weeks and months that followed, Jimmy cost Jey big matches on numerous occasions. Jimmy was responsible for Jey and Cody Rhodes dropping the Undisputed WWE Tag Team Championships to Damian Priest and Finn Bálor, and he also interfered during an Intercontinental Championship match between Jey and Gunther.
The loss to Gunther was the last straw for Jey, as he laid down a WrestleMania challenge to his brother on Raw a few weeks ago, and Jimmy accepted on the ensuing episode of SmackDown.
Both Jey and Jimmy spoke candidly in past interviews about their personal dream matches being a clash against each other at WrestleMania, and they finally got that opportunity this year.
Given the importance of the match to both competitors, it came as no surprise that they both went all-out, but it was Jey who emerged with the victory at The Showcase of the Immortals.
